The Garmin Vivoactive 5 42mm sits in a sweet spot for athletes who want serious fitness tracking without the complexity of flagship models. After weeks of testing everything from daily runs to weekend hikes, this smartwatch delivers where it matters: accurate data, impressive battery life, and a display that's genuinely beautiful outdoors and indoors. It's not perfect—some menus feel buried, and it won't replace your phone for notifications—but if you're looking for a reliable companion for workouts and daily activity tracking, this is worth your attention.

Verdict

The Garmin Vivoactive 5 42mm is an excellent fitness watch for athletes and active people who prioritize battery life and reliable data over cutting-edge smartwatch features. Its 11-day battery, sharp AMOLED screen, and powerful health tracking make it a standout in its category. The navigation quirks and lack of advanced smart features are minor trade-offs for a device that excels at what it's designed to do. This watch pairs perfectly with runners, cyclists, hikers, and fitness enthusiasts who want their training data to be accurate without constant charging anxiety. In my testing, GPS accuracy was excellent, staying within 10 meters of measured routes. It uses multi-GNSS (GPS, GLONASS, Galileo, QZSS) for better coverage, especially in challenging environments like dense forests or urban areas with tall buildings.

You can receive notifications of texts and calls, but text replies are limited—you can only use preset quick responses on compatible Android devices. Full text composition isn't possible, so this isn't a watch for managing messages.

Yes, the Vivoactive 5 pairs with both iOS and Android. However, iPhone users have fewer notification features (no music control), while Android users get more comprehensive smartwatch integration.

11 days in smartwatch mode is exceptional—most competitors like Apple Watch last 1.5-2 days, and Garmin's Forerunner series typically achieves 6-8 days. The trade-off: Garmin sacrifices standalone apps and advanced features for this battery advantage.
